登录 注册

登录

问题 如何在内容管理中添加新的字段?

更多
2007年12月17日 11:43 #1 作者: SeasMood
我有一个老的MYSQL表, 想用joomla来做展示.
这个是手机相关的, 有字段: 厂商, 型号, 数目, 性能, 颜色, 价格.
但是不知道如何修改Joomla, 使它能够存储并展示我的数据.
有没有现成的extention能够实现这个功能?
或者必须开发新的插件?

登录 或者   注册一个会员帐号 来参与讨论

更多
2007年12月17日 17:20 #2 作者: Joomla之门
似乎没有见到完全符合你这个数据表结构的 Joomla! 组件。不过,该文件仍然有用。我的建议是这样的:

1、选择一款自己想要的产品展示组件;

2、安装该组件并创建一个/一类产品,使其数据表中生成数据;

3、按照该组件的数据表结构来重新调整原有 MySQL 文件中的数据结构;

4、删除在组件中刚才创建的临时产品,导入调整后的原有 sql 文件。

不过,可能存在现有展示组件所用字段无法全部与现有数据表中字段一一映射。

付费下载 Joomla 3 扩展汉化版: 我要付费支持 Joomla 之门!

登录 或者   注册一个会员帐号 来参与讨论

更多
2007年12月17日 22:47 #3 作者: SeasMood
谢谢老大的回答.
你的建议很好, 看来也只能这样了.
能推荐一些比较好的产品展示组件么? 我翻了一下, 就找到一个展示车子的好像比较适合,是收费组件.

登录 或者   注册一个会员帐号 来参与讨论

更多
2007年12月18日 08:40 #4 作者: Joomla之门
目前没有特别满意的产品展示组件。

我昨晚又对此问题作了一点研究,发现有一个叫做 Database Query 的组件或许能够从另一个角度解决这个问题:该组件能够从现有数据库中提取数据,以表单()形式展示出来。

那么,是否可以这样做:将你现有的数据库导入到Joomla!数据库中,用特别的数据表前缀区别开,如 old_ ;或者假如你有权限创建多个数据库,可以基于现有 sql 文件创建一个新的数据库;

然后,用 Database Query 组件来提取你的数据并展示在前台(或许能够自定义提取的字段顺序及数量)。

这个组件我还没有汉化,不过看起来用户评价不错,准备抽空汉化了。如果你着急,可以先试用英文版。在试用时注意做好数据备份,以免“不成功,又成仁”。

付费下载 Joomla 3 扩展汉化版: 我要付费支持 Joomla 之门!

登录 或者   注册一个会员帐号 来参与讨论

更多
2007年12月18日 23:00 #5 作者: SeasMood
看了建议我又去翻了一下Database Query, 这个组件挺强的, 在数据库方面已经能满足要求了. 就是展示方面修改的工作量可能大一点.
我得找个时间尝试一下.谢谢.

登录 或者   注册一个会员帐号 来参与讨论

更多
2007年12月19日 07:43 #6 作者: Joomla之门
是的,我咨询了数据库高手 hoping,他也说如果能解决自定义输出问题,那么 Database Query 就很牛了。

看起来你也是数据库方面的老手了,希望你摸索一下 Database Query 的用法,将来熟练了,请回来写篇文章介绍一下你定制该组件的经验吧,谢谢!

付费下载 Joomla 3 扩展汉化版: 我要付费支持 Joomla 之门!

登录 或者   注册一个会员帐号 来参与讨论

更多
2010年02月11日 10:38 #7 作者: Joomla之门
Joomla 自带的文章系统功能太简陋了,没法实现自定义字段。

如果你的 Joomla 网站特别需要这样的功能,建议使用其它内容管理组件来替代 Joomla 内置的 com_content 文章系统。

例如:本站最近汉化的 点此下载 FLEXIcontent for Joomla! 1.5 高级内容管理组件(CCK)中文版 就允许用户自定义字段,还可以自定义文章类型。

付费下载 Joomla 3 扩展汉化版: 我要付费支持 Joomla 之门!

登录 或者   注册一个会员帐号 来参与讨论

更多
2012年03月02日 06:30 #8 作者: sjww1410
謝謝啦,又多學了一項技巧。 :lol:

登录 或者   注册一个会员帐号 来参与讨论

  • liuyouhui
  • liuyouhui 的头像
  • 离线
  • 终身会员
  • 终身会员
  • 网站开源解决方案:Joomla/Drupal/x-cart/Typo3
更多
2012年03月02日 09:00 #9 作者: liuyouhui
K2和zoo是对joomla自定义字段的很好的补充。

Joomla定制开发:内容/电商/社区 www.osforce.com.cn

登录 或者   注册一个会员帐号 来参与讨论